Job Description:

As an Email Marketing Executive, you will be responsible for developing and executing email marketing campaigns to promote our products, services, and brand. You will collaborate closely with the marketing team to design and implement email strategies that drive engagement, increase customer acquisition, and maximize revenue. Your role will involve managing email databases, crafting compelling content, analyzing campaign performance, and optimizing email campaigns for better results.

Responsibilities:

Develop and execute email marketing campaigns aligned with marketing objectives and target audience.

Create engaging email content, including promotional materials, newsletters, and announcements, tailored to various customer segments.

Manage email databases, segment lists based on criteria such as demographics and past engagement, and maintain data hygiene.

Design and implement automated email workflows, including welcome sequences, abandoned cart reminders, and re-engagement campaigns.

Collaborate with the design team to create visually appealing email templates and graphics.

Conduct A/B testing on subject lines, email content, and calls-to-action to optimize campaign performance.

Monitor key email metrics such as open rates, click-through rates, and conversion rates, and provide insights to enhance campaign effectiveness.

Stay updated on industry trends, best practices, and regulations related to email marketing, including GDPR and CAN-SPAM compliance.

Work cross-functionally with other teams such as product, sales, and customer support to align email marketing efforts with overall business objectives.

Generate reports and dashboards to track and analyze the performance of email marketing initiatives, and make data-driven recommendations for improvement.

Continuously evaluate and refine email strategies to improve deliverability, engagement, and ROI.

Stay informed about emerging email marketing tools and technologies, and recommend new solutions to enhance campaign effectiveness and efficiency.

Requirements:

Bachelor's degree in marketing, communications, or a related field.

Proven experience in email marketing, preferably in a B2C or B2B environment.

Proficiency in email marketing platforms such as Mailchimp, Constant Contact, or HubSpot.

Strong copywriting and editing skills, with the ability to craft compelling and persuasive content.

Excellent analytical skills, with the ability to interpret data and derive actionable insights.

Familiarity with HTML/CSS for email template customization is a plus.

Ability to work independently, prioritize tasks, and me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ment.

Strong communication and collaboration skills, with the ability to work effectively in a cross-functional team.

Detail-oriented with a focus on quality and accuracy.

A passion for marketing and a desire to stay ahead of industry trends and best practices.
